How much does it cost to rent an apartment in East Derry?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
East Derry Studio Apartments | $2,209 | $1,435 | $2,505 |
East Derry 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,330 | $1,295 | $4,216 |
East Derry 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,933 | $1,395 | $4,725 |
East Derry 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,324 | $1,795 | $7,065 |
